The “Long-Term Investment Program for Forestry (1950/1952)” funded a broad spectrum of measures. These included logging (e.g. construction of forest roads), reforestation, forest protection, a forest survey, forest research and thinning. These were not only financially funded, but also supported by an additional program which was named Technical Assistance Program (TAP). Austrian forestry representatives went on study excursions to the USA, to study American forestry first hand. The people who took part in these excursions where supposed to act as multipliers and bring American productivity (a key issue of the ERP) to the Austrian forests.
